Camp Randall Rowing Club is a non-profit, volunteer club offering year-round junior competitive rowing program for high school students from all over Dane County, as well as programs for middle school students and a We Can Row program for female cancer survivors. We participate in regattas across the Midwest both in the spring and fall. We practice out of the Brittingham Boathouse on Monona Bay in Madison. When we’re not rowing on Lake Monona, we cross-train, run, and row on
rowing machines (ergs). We do a lot of erging!

CRRC practices out of the Brittingham Boathouse. The Brittingham Boathouse is the oldest surviving parks building in Madison. It pre-dates the Madison Parks Division.
